Trojan Takeover

Sabercats go 0-2 in Missouri

LEAD

HANNIBAL, Mo. -- Maranatha couldn't match Hannibal-LeGrange at bat, falling 1-16 and 0-11 in the double-header. 

Lindsay Mikkelson led the Sabercats with two hits on the day, followed by Ashley Nerat and Kaili Swaffer who each recorded one. 

OVERVIEW

  • Results Game One: Maranatha 1-16 Hannibal LeGrange (five-innings)
  • Results Game Two: Maranatha 0-11 Hannibal LeGrange (five-innings)
  • Venue: HLGU Field - Hannibal, Missouri
  • Attendance: 25
  • Records: MBU (0-4), HLGU (2-20)

STORY

Game 1
Hannibal-LeGrange got the bats going early in the game, recording one triple, one double, and three single's to give them a 3-0 lead after the first inning. Lindsay Mikkelson started things off for the Sabercats at the top of the second, after crushing a triple out to right field. But unfortunately she was left stranded, as two stike-outs sent Maranatha back to the field.

While the Trojans continued to hit the gaps throughout the next two innings, upping their score to 12-0 after the third, it wasn't until the top of the fourth when things started to look promising for the Sabercats. After a couple of walks and a single from Kaili Swaffer, Maranatha found themselves in a bases loaded scenario. One more walk sent Bethany Searle home, putting Maranatha on the board for their first run of the season. 

But that's all the Sabercats could produce, eventually falling 1-16 after five-innings. 

Game 2
The Sabercats showed improvement in the second game, despite having some rough patches. In the bottom of the first and third innings, fielding errors from Maranatha awarded the Trojans a combined 9 runs. But, solid defense in the second and fourth kept Hannibal-LeGrange to one run in each. 

Offensively, the Sabercats could not get a handle at bat, going three and out in all but the first inning resulting in a 0-11 loss.
